Prestige Construction Scale of Operations - 40 Years Legacy

Featured Image of Prestige Construction Scale of Operations - 40 Years Legacy


The Prestige Construction scale of operations in 2026 is built on 40 years of real estate development across 13 cities. Prestige has completed 319 projects covering 216 million sq. ft. The company also has 67 ongoing projects with 144 million sq. ft. and 70 upcoming projects covering another 85 million sq. ft. This gives Prestige a large active pipeline even after four decades of development.

Prestige has also expanded far beyond apartment construction. Its business now covers residential, commercial, retail, hospitality, and property management and other services. The group develops apartments, villas, townships, offices, IT parks, malls, hotels, resorts and plotted communities. This wide mix is one of the main reasons its scale has grown across different parts of Indian real estate.

Prestige Construction Scale of Operations in 2026


Prestige divides its project base into completed, ongoing and upcoming developments. The company has delivered 319 projects, while 67 projects are currently under development and 70 are in the future pipeline. The ongoing portfolio alone covers 144 million sq. ft. The upcoming portfolio adds another 85 million sq. ft., taking the combined active and future area to 229 million sq. ft.

Project Status Number of Projects Area
Completed 319 216 mn sq. ft.
Ongoing 67 144 mn sq. ft.
Upcoming 70 85 mn sq. ft.

The ongoing and upcoming area together is slightly larger than the 216 million sq. ft. Prestige has already completed. This gives a clear view of the size of its present construction pipeline.

Residential Is the Largest Part of Prestige Construction


Residential development forms the largest part of the Prestige portfolio shown in the report. The company has completed 165 residential projects covering 145 million sq. ft. Another 48 residential projects covering 117 million sq. ft. are ongoing, while 35 upcoming projects cover 53 million sq. ft.

The residential business includes apartments, villas, integrated townships and plotted developments. Prestige also uses large formats such as The Prestige City and Prestige Golfshire for some developments. This wide residential base gives the company projects at different price points, sizes and stages of construction.

Prestige Commercial Construction Scale


Commercial real estate is another major part of Prestige's operations. The company has completed 129 commercial projects covering 57 million sq. ft. It also has 10 ongoing commercial projects covering 18 million sq. ft. and 12 upcoming projects covering 17 million sq. ft.

Prestige's commercial work includes office spaces, built-to-suit campuses, corporate offices, IT parks, warehouses and industrial parks. This means the company's construction scale is not driven by housing alone. Offices and business spaces form a large second part of the overall portfolio.

Prestige Retail Construction Portfolio


Prestige has also built a separate retail business over the years. The company reports 13 completed retail projects covering 10 million sq. ft. It has 5 ongoing retail projects covering 5 million sq. ft. and another 8 projects covering 8 million sq. ft. in the future pipeline.

The retail segment includes malls, multiplexes, food and beverage spaces, luxury retail and performing arts areas. Forum South Bengaluru is one of the retail examples shown in the company's presentation. This segment adds shopping and leisure spaces to Prestige's wider construction portfolio.

Prestige Hospitality and Other Services


Prestige's operations also extend into hospitality. The company develops hotels, convention centres, service apartments, resorts and golf resorts. Sheraton Grand Bengaluru Whitefield Hotel & Convention Centre is shown as one example in the investor presentation.

Prestige also works in property management, interiors and construction contracting. Its other services cover facades, doors and custom furniture. These areas support the main development business and allow the group to work beyond the construction and sale of a property.

Prestige Construction Presence Across 13 Cities


Prestige reports a presence in 13 cities. Its current residential and future project lists include major markets such as Bengaluru, Hyderabad, Mumbai, Chennai and NCR, along with several other locations.

The project pipeline also includes markets such as Goa, Kochi, Mangaluru and Mysore. This wider reach has helped Prestige build a portfolio that is not tied to one city or one property type.

Prestige Construction Ratings and Company Profile


Prestige also lists several company-level ratings in its latest presentation. It has a CRISIL DA1+ “Excellent” Developer Grading and an ICRA A+ “Stable” rating. The company is also Great Place to Work certified.

Its NSE ESG score is reported as 68, with the status marked as “Aspiring.” These ratings do not measure project size, but they form part of Prestige's wider company profile after 40 years in real estate.
